Output 83d068126a79c079e01fcba794b6b7ed38efa5358c7a5cdf9fe04edf2076ff64:1

value
10477756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fe8015702da1f575eddde64897d59893d288337 OP_EQUAL
address
34bioVmLBiWkHanH1paEizW1icD6AJ1NQH
transaction
83d068126a79c079e01fcba794b6b7ed38efa5358c7a5cdf9fe04edf2076ff64
spent
true